Mayock on McCluster at the Senior Bowl...

I always record the Senior Bowl to watch after the draft to see the players we drafted. This year there are 3. All on the South roster. Arenas, McCluster, and Sheffield.

At the top of the show, Mayock is talking about 3 players that really caught his eye. Wilson from Boise State, Iupati from Idaho, and McCluster. Here is what he said about Mccluster...

"And finally the wow factor. Dexter McCluster, 5-8, 165. He is a lightning rod of opinion, but he is a playmaker at tailback where he will start today. But where he blew me away was at wide receiver. His route running. His hands. You can line him up anywhere you want. And really his only limitations, in my mind, is the creativity of whatever offensive coordinator that is lucky enough to get him."

Just finished watching. We drafted 3 very good players. Mayock had very good things to say about all three of these guys throughout the game. On Arenas, he said he is one of his favorite players in all of college football. But, he expects him to be a nickel corner because he is very quick in short the short area, but lacks the long speed. Shortly thereafter, Arenas broke a 62 yard punt return, that he got ran down from behind by a player that had the bigtime angle on Arenas. Mayock stated that that return sums up Arenas's ability perfectly.

We got some good players guys.
